What Is GHK-Cu?
GHK-Cu (Glycyl-L-Histidyl-L-Lysine Copper Complex) is a copper-binding tripeptide studied exclusively within structured laboratory environments. In UK research settings, it is examined for:
- Cellular and molecular signalling research
- Extracellular matrix modelling
- In-vitro peptide interaction analysis
- Stability and degradation profiling
- Comparative laboratory peptide studies
In the United Kingdom, GHK-Cu is supplied strictly for research use only and is not authorised for medical, cosmetic, or veterinary use.

Storage & Handling in UK Laboratory Environments
Maintaining peptide stability requires strict handling procedures:
- Store at –20°C or lower
- Protect from moisture and direct light
- Minimise freeze–thaw cycles
- Use sterile laboratory-grade equipment
- Clearly label all aliquots with batch information
Proper storage reduces degradation risk and maintains consistency across long-term research projects.
